Super Powers
Misty had always wanted to be a superhero. Every Halloween, she designed costumes so she could look like a hero. She often had a mask or a cape or some other design to her costumes so everyone could tell she was someone who could save the world. As many times as she had pretended to be a hero, no one was more surprised than she when she actually developed her own special powers.
One day, as she looked into the mirror, Misty realized she could no longer see herself. She had become invisible! She had no idea what had caused the transformation or how long her powers would last, but she wasn’t about to waste a second. She hit the streets running, looking for criminals, and surprising them when they didn’t realize anyone was there. By the end of the day, she had stopped three bank robbers and two shoplifters. It had been a wonderful day even if she hadn’t been able to wear a cool superhero costume.
The next day, she woke-up and discovered she was still invisible. She went back out and did much of what she had done the day before. Whispers of some unknown hero were starting to spread through the streets. Newspaper journalists scrambled to write stories, but no one knew who the new hero was or where to find the helpful citizen. Misty smiled to herself. If they only knew, she thought, they wouldn’t believe it. She could barely believe it herself. After an entire week of being a superhero, Misty was starting to become a bit tired. Being a hero was a good thing, but it took a lot of work to run from place to place, catching criminals and tying up bad guys. She was tired and cranky, and since she couldn’t see her reflection, she had no idea if she looked as bad as she was starting to feel.
The next morning, Misty woke up and caught sight of her reflection in the mirror. She grinned when she saw that she could see herself again. She knew it was the end to her days as a superhero, but it didn’t mean she had to stop helping people. That day, as she went into work, she held the door open for three people and helped two elderly people carry their groceries. Granted, she wasn’t saving the world anymore, but it still felt good to help in any way she could!
